Edited by: Sylaan on 22/03/2004 08:03:25 The security status of the system does not matter. Actually, you want it to be as high as possible so the angent wont send you to a 0.4 system where you can be attacked by PC pirates.
Yes, you can make 150k per mission for an agent, and much more than that. What you need is a high quality agent (30+). Also decent standing, Connections skill helps with that (you should have it at atleast 3). Then if you want to maximize your mission rewards you should work for a military corporation. If you do that, you'll get mostly kill missions. I work for Caldari Navy and I get 95% kill missions. Within a maximum of 2 jumps, never more (agent quality is 34 at the moment). With this is not unusual to get a mission with reward 70-100k, bonus 70-110k and in which you have to kill something like 3x34k, 1x85k and 2x35k, 2x75k. Not to mention loot. My best was 340k or so in one mission and a named 250mm rail.
And of course, there is the chance of the odd implant every now and then. But you need a cruiser to do those missions, and a high-end one too I would say. Anything less would make it ... somewhat dangerous for you
